Join our team as a Senior Software Engineer and play a crucial role in designing, developing, and implementing secure software solutions to protect our organisation from cyber threats. You will work with a team of engineers to build secure, highly available, fault-tolerant, and globally performant microservices-based platform deployed on the AWS cloud.
Requirements
2+ years of experience in a software engineering role.
Proficiency in Python, Go and/or Typescript, with a comprehensive understanding of object-oriented programming (OOP) principles.
Proficiency or working knowledge of UI tools and frameworks such as React or Angular.
Familiarity with AWS technologies such as EC2, Fargate, Lambda, S3, CloudWatch etc.
Experience with CI/CD workflows, Kubernetes, GitHub Actions, and other DevOps tools.